Transaction 50943367983979a0977eab80d39cb41267621a115a33333f1bf9281c589eed86

1 Input
2 Outputs
  • 50943367983979a0977eab80d39cb41267621a115a33333f1bf9281c589eed86:0
  • value  2128301
    address  1QHpMertQNqDUDi36PZZHnGetzqdKRAbFm
  • 50943367983979a0977eab80d39cb41267621a115a33333f1bf9281c589eed86:1
  • value  1541159
    address  bc1qw7qaclaz9ag0esnaes26kn72mjcwgyq8yxk2h5